Initially, survey the surface to try to find any type of cracks or openings between blocks. You must fix them before you start stress washing. Carefully patch these locations with mortar and allow them treat for a minimum of a week. Screen Enclosure Cleaning. Once they're dry, you can start pressure washing. Prep your surface: Soak and saturate the block with water.


Evaluate a location: Examine a little location of brick in order to evaluate the quantity of pressure required to complete the cleaning job at hand. Detergent: Apply a detergent for cleansing block, spray the detergent from bottom to top in order to protect against spotting and after that enable it to saturate right into the brick for 5-10 minutes.

Preparation your surface: Pick up and relocate things like grass furnishings, toys and potted plants that could be damaged throughout pressure washing.


Pressure washing: When the cleaning agent has actually permeated your concrete, it's time to blow up away all the gathered accumulation. Switch over to a high-pressure spray, maintain your nozzle at least 10 inches away from the surface area and usage smooth back and forth movements, overlapping each pass by 5 or even more inches.

Prep your area: Remove any kind of objects and/or cover plants and bushes near the fencing line. This will certainly provide you straight access to the fencing and protect against damages. Quick Connect Nozzles: Select the best quick attach nozzle. We advise a 25-degree nozzle to start. If you need more power, you can always switch to a 15-degree nozzle.


The Ultimate Guide To Martz Pressure Washing




Cleaning agent: Apply a cleaning agent we advise a business grade cleaning agent while holding the sprayer around 3 to 4 feet away from the fence's surface. Let the cleaning remedy sink in and do its magic for regarding 10 mins. For wood secure fencing, do not hold the sprayer in one place, as it may trigger damages to the wood.

Due to the fact that concrete is permeable, pollutants saturate right into the surface of the concrete, needing a good amount of stress to effectively flush them out. Another instance where stress can be useful is in preparing to paint or reseal your deck. With the appropriate amount of stress, a whole lot of loose paint and sunspots can be taken off by pressure cleaning.


Soft washing is the finest technique for house siding, with the specific quantity of stress varying by the type of house siding on your home.
